    Top Tips for Maintaining Your Business’s Electrical System

    A well-functioning electrical system is the backbone of any commercial property. It powers everything from lights and computers to security systems and HVAC equipment. When electrical problems arise, they can disrupt your business operations, lead to safety hazards, and cost you money. That’s why having a reliable commercial electrical contractor on your side is essential.

    This article will explore the importance of commercial electrical system repair and the role of qualified electrical contractors in maintaining a safe and efficient electrical system for your business.

    Importance of Regular Maintenance

    Regular preventive maintenance of the electrical system in your building is as important as regular maintenance of any other systems in your building. Frequently testing for electrical hazards by a licensed electrician would be useful for identifying small problems before they resorted into major ones. These proactive measures will not only eliminate future expensive repairs, but also reduce your business’s off-time.

    When to Call a Commercial Electrical Contractor for Repairs

    Despite this, electrical issues may still happen at times in spite of our maintenance practices.

    • Flickering lights: This can be a clue of a loose connection, an overloaded circuit, or a burned-out bulb.
    • Burning smells: Such an event is a serious fire hazard and requires immediate assistance from an electrician.
    • Buzzing sounds: Such an occurrence may thus suggest a condition of bad wires, overloaded circuits, or malfunctioning transformers.
    • Tripped breakers or blown fuses: It is this that makes a circuit get overloaded. Although resetting the breaker or replacing the fuse could be the immediate solution, a professional electrician must be called to identify what has led to the overload.
    • Inoperable outlets: It might be as a result of a tripped breaker, a blown fuse, or faulty wiring.

    Finding the Right Electrical Contractor

    When it comes to commercial electrical system repair, it’s crucial to choose a qualified and experienced contractor. Here are some factors to consider when making your selection:

    • Licensing and insurance: Ensure the contractor is licensed in your state and carries liability insurance.
    • Experience: Look for a contractor with experience working on commercial electrical systems similar to yours.
    • References: Ask for references from past clients and check online reviews.
    • Safety record: Inquire about the contractor’s safety record and ensure they follow all safety protocols on the job site.
    • Warranties: Ask about the warranties offered on the contractor’s work and materials.

    By taking the time to find a reputable electrical contractor, you can ensure that your commercial electrical system is repaired safely and efficiently.
